请问一个菜鸟问题-功能实现
请问一个窗体中的控件的功能 能不能在另一个窗体中实现?
如果可以,怎么实现?谢谢
[解决办法]
可以,调用,在另一个窗体的uses中调用如第一窗体为form1 控件为bubtton1(这里先写好要实现的功能),另一个窗体为form2,这样就可以在第二个窗体中写下
uses
unit2;
{$R *.dfm}
//然后调用就可
form1.button1onclick(nil);
[解决办法]
新他的窗体继承主窗体的form类
[解决办法]
新窗体 申明事件,如:OnChange
主窗体 注册事件,Form2.OnChange = MyProc
新窗体 触发事件,OnChange(self, nil)
主窗体 响应事件,-
procedure MyProc(object sender, Eventargs e)
begin
进行窗体控件操作
end;
[解决办法]
用Action.
放一个ActionList,然后功能代码写在Action里,链接这些Action即可.